The Great Netflix Escape
Unfortunately, Prison Break did its own escape from Netflix. It wasn't a Shawshank Redemption slow crawl, but it still stung for fans. You can't find it on Netflix anymore.
Must Read
Dates can be tricky because Netflix changes its content all the time. One minute it's there, the next it's doing the Houdini. It vanished from US Netflix around 2018.
However, always double check, as Netflix libraries vary around the world. It might be available in another country, but its time on US Netflix is over.

Beyond the Bars: What Made it Special
Prison Break wasn't just about escaping prison (though that was a big part of it). It was about family, loyalty, and fighting for what's right.
The relationship between Michael and his brother, Lincoln Burrows, was the heart of the show. Their bond gave the high-octane action some real emotional weight.
And the supporting characters! Sucre, T-Bag (terrifying but fascinating), Sara Tancredi – they all added layers of complexity and intrigue. The cast was phenomenal and had great chemistry.

The twists and turns kept you on the edge of your seat. Every episode ended on a cliffhanger. It was impossible to watch just one!
Where to Find Your Prison Break Fix Now
So, Netflix is a no-go. Where can you get your Prison Break fix? Don't worry, you have options!
Hulu currently streams all seasons. You can get your fix of Scofields genius and T-Bags' menace there.

You can also rent or buy episodes or seasons on platforms like Amazon Prime Video and Apple TV.
Physical copies are always an option, too. Nothing like owning the DVDs or Blu-rays for a truly dedicated fan. The box art looks so cool.
